Frequently Asked Questions about Washington

What type of rentals are currently available in Washington?

There are currently 206 Apartments for Rent in Washington, ND with pricing that ranges from $410 to $2,950. There are also 33 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Washington ranging from $650 to $2,495.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Washington?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Washington ranges from $650 to $2,495 with an average monthly rent of $1,575.

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Washington?

For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Washington range from $985 to $2,950,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,550 to $1,900.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,735 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,700.
